AI Summary
-
Establishes a pilot program allowing the Michigan Department of State to provide skills testing for individuals holding valid commercial learner's permits from other states.
-
Requires individuals to have completed a truck driver training curriculum approved by the department from an approved training provider under the 2006 Driver Education Provider and Instructor Act.
-
Limits eligibility to individuals whose home state participates in an electronic national commercial driver examination reporting system that Michigan also participates in.
-
Pilot program continues until the department adopts curriculum requirements for instructors teaching vehicle group designations or endorsements under section 312e.
-
Effective date: February 20, 2017 (90 days after enactment on November 22, 2016).
Legislative Description
Traffic control; driver license; pilot program for vehicle group designation testing of an individual holding a valid commercial license permit issued by another state; establish. Amends 1949 PA 300 (MCL 257.1 - 257.923) & adds sec. 312j.
